1. Consider how your patio will function as a living space and be utilized by your family. Construct it or enhance its appearance with materials from nature such as wood and stone. Design it to be a natural extension of the rest of your home’s architecture. Your outdoor living space should be accessible from one or two of your main living spaces so there is a natural flow from interior to exterior living. Patios should be at least as large as the room(s) from which they flow. At least 400 square feet of patio space is needed to comfortably accommodate a family of four and their activities.
2. Your family’s lifestyle and decor preferences should be reflected in any piece acquired through a patio furniture clearance event. Do you prefer the traditional, modern, Mediterranean or cottage style? Furniture materials should be weather resistant and stand up against damaging effects of the sun. Cedar is rot and insect resistant. Wrought iron is strong enough to bear the weight of snowfalls.
3. Furniture makers suggest and sometimes limit the choices of appropriate colors and materials offered for each piece’s cushions or chair pads, furniture covers and table umbrellas. While selecting the color or design you want for your patio’s look, be sure to check on the strength and quality of all upholstery. There are many beautiful outdoor cushions that you can choose from. Materials that are tear resistant, waterproof and long-lived will hold up better under strenuous use by active families and through all kinds of weather. Higher altitudes require UV resistant materials because of typical problems found in higher ranges, such as brittle and faded covers.
